Plot Summary

A teenage girl named Elvira is preparing for her confirmation when she learns that her estranged biological father, a well-known musician, has died. She embarks on a journey to find out more about him and his life, which leads her to uncover family secrets and a hidden past. Along the way, she meets new people who help her understand herself and her place in the world.

Critical Reception

La vida received generally positive reviews, with critics praising its emotional depth and strong performances, particularly from the young lead actress. The film was noted for its sensitive portrayal of complex family dynamics and themes of identity and belonging. Audience reception was also favorable, resonating with viewers who appreciated its heartfelt narrative.
